Time the record covers
At least 15 million years on record.
The record covers at least 168.2 Mya to 152.21 Mya. No occurrence read is dated outside 170.9 Mya to 149.2 Mya.
12 occurrences of Gymnocidaris on record, most of them in the Late Jurassic.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.
